Nate Silver / FiveThirtyEight.com:
Post-VP Debate Thoughts  —  As with the Obama-McCain debate last Friday, the vast majority of the insta-polls went to the Democratic ticket.  Biden won the CBS poll of undecideds 46-21, and the CNN poll of debate watchers 51-36.  Independents in the large MediaCurves focus group panel went for Biden about 2:1.

Mike Allen / The Politico:
McCain fate hangs on three states  —  ST. LOUIS — Sen. John McCain (R-Ariz.) now must win Pennsylvania, Wisconsin or Minnesota in order to get enough electoral votes to win the presidency, his campaign says.  —  Those were considered swing states in 2000 and 2004, but George W. Bush lost them both times.
